I recently purchased the game Deadly Premonition; a game I'm sure some of you are familiar with. It has a really novel-esque feel to it, and has influenced me to start playing some of my other story-rich 360 games. Here's a list of the games I already have which are rich in story (in my opinion!), and I'd like some recommendations for similar games, or games YOU enjoyed for their powerful stories. Deadly Premonition, Alan Wake, Dead Space 1 & 2, Bioshock 1 & 2, Oblivion & Skyrim, Mass Effect 1 & 2, Assassin's Creed & AC2 & Brotherhood, Dragon Age Origins, Fallout 3 & New Vegas, Red Dead Redemption & GTA IV, LA Noire and Deus Ex: Human Revolution. I'll look into any and every answer, thank you. (P.S. - I haven't delved into any Japanese RPG / Action games yet, feel free to post about them too!)

Lots of really good mentions for games with good stories. Some of my favorites are already mentioned such as Mass Effect 1 & 2, Alan Wake, LA Noire, and Red Dead Redemption. I have a wild card suggestion. Call of Juarez: Bound in Blood. It's a very good solid game all around. It's the second best western game I played. For a while it was my favorite western game (until RDR came out). Story was very gripping with temptation, religion, and such. I won't spoil it, but if you're wanting a good solid story, this game has one and its overlooked.

I would recommend the Portal games. The first Portal because it's subtle and the story sneaks up on you. Portal 2 because it's has more traditional story telling, but with excellent pacing, writing and voice acting.
